What is a CMS?
A Content Management System (CMS) is a tool that helps you create and manage website content without having to know how to code. Itโs like a backstage crew that handles all the technical parts of your website while you focus on adding content.
What is a Website Builder?
A website builder is a simple tool that allows anyone to create a website quickly. Think of it as a ready-made kit where everything is includedโyou just pick a design and add your content.

Who Should Use a CMS?
A CMS is best for people who:
Need a highly customizable website.
Are comfortable learning new tools or have access to a developer.
Run a business or blog that requires advanced features.
Who Should Use a Website Builder?
A website builder is ideal for:
Individuals creating personal websites or portfolios.
Small businesses with simple website needs.
Anyone who wants a quick, easy, and affordable solution.

FAQs
- 1. Can I switch from a website builder to a CMS later?Yes, but itโs not always easy. You might need technical help to transfer your content and redesign your site.
- 2. Which is cheaper: a CMS or a website builder?Website builders often have lower upfront costs, while CMS platforms can become more expensive depending on your needs.
